Role of Inflammation in Initiation and Perpetuation of Atrial Fibrillation

Atrial fibrillation (AF) is the most common arrhythmia in clinical practice. Recent studies have indicated that inflammation might play a significant role in the initiation, maintenance, and perpetuation of AF. Prognostic significance of atrial fibrillation in dilated cardiomyopathy.

We evaluated the relation of atrial rhythm to a clinical course of treatment in 147 patients diagnosed with dilated cardiomyopathy (DCM). Thirty-six of the patients (24%) had either transient (9 patients) or persistent (27 patients) atrial fibrillation (AF). The mechanisms of atrial fibrillation in hyperthyroidism

Atrial fibrillation (AF) is a complex condition with several possible contributing factors. The rapid and irregular heartbeat produced by AF increases the risk of blood clot formation inside the heart.
